The Importance of Competitive Odds and Value

While a wide range of betting options and a user-friendly interface are important, the odds offered by a platform are often the deciding factor for users. Competitive odds translate directly into potential returns, and even small differences can accumulate over time. Platforms employ complex algorithms and data analysis to determine their odds, taking into account factors such as team form, player injuries, historical performance, and public sentiment. However, comparing odds across different platforms is a common practice for savvy users seeking to maximize their potential winnings. Understanding the concept of ‘value’ in betting – identifying situations where the odds offered are higher than the perceived probability of an outcome – is a crucial skill for anyone serious about engaging in this activity.

Responsible Gaming and Platform Security

A reputable sports engagement platform prioritizes responsible gaming practices. This includes providing tools and resources to help users manage their betting activity, such as deposit limits, loss limits, and self-exclusion options. These features are designed to promote a healthy relationship with betting and prevent problematic behavior. Look for platforms that actively promote responsible gaming messaging and collaborate with organizations dedicated to gambling awareness. Transparent terms and conditions, clearly outlining the rules and regulations governing the platform, are also essential. Users should always be aware of the risks involved and gamble within their means.

Equally important is the security of the platform itself. Protecting user data and financial transactions is paramount. Reliable platforms utilize advanced encryption technology to safeguard sensitive information and employ robust security protocols to prevent fraud and unauthorized access. Look for platforms that are licensed and regulated by reputable authorities, as this provides an additional layer of assurance and oversight. The presence of secure payment gateways and a clear data privacy policy are also indicators of a secure and trustworthy platform.

Strategies for Responsible Betting

Adopting a responsible approach to betting is essential for maintaining a positive and enjoyable experience. This involves setting clear limits on both time and money spent, treating betting as a form of entertainment rather than a source of income, and avoiding chasing losses. Researching teams and events thoroughly before placing bets is also crucial, as is understanding the odds and potential risks involved. Avoid betting under the influence of alcohol or emotions, and always be prepared to walk away if you are experiencing a losing streak. Finally, seeking help if you feel your betting activity is becoming problematic is a sign of strength, not weakness.

  • Set a budget and stick to it.
  • Only bet what you can afford to lose.
  • Do your research before placing bets.
  • Avoid chasing losses.
  • Take breaks and don't let betting consume your life.

Implementing these strategies can help ensure that your engagement with sports betting remains a controlled and enjoyable activity.

Exploring Emerging Trends in Sports Fan Engagement

The future of sports fan engagement is likely to be shaped by several emerging trends. One key area is the integration of virtual reality (VR) and augmented reality (AR) technologies, which have the potential to create immersive and interactive experiences for fans. Imagine being able to watch a game from a virtual courtside seat or experience a simulated replay from a player's perspective. Another trend is the growing importance of personalization, with platforms leveraging data analytics to deliver increasingly tailored content and betting recommendations. The rise of micro-betting – placing wagers on very specific events within a game, such as the outcome of the next play – is also gaining traction, offering fans even more opportunities to engage with the action in real-time. Finally, the integration of blockchain technology could enhance transparency and security in the betting process.

These innovations are poised to redefine the sports fan experience, creating new opportunities for engagement and interaction. Platforms that embrace these trends and prioritize user-centric design will be best positioned to succeed in the evolving digital landscape. It’s important to remember, however, that technology is merely an enabler. The fundamental principles of responsible gaming, data security, and user trust remain paramount, regardless of the technological advancements that emerge.
